What are the main differences between durian and loquat?
Durian is richer in vitamin B1, vitamin C, copper, vitamin B6, vitamin B2, fiber, manganese, vitamin B3, and folate, yet loquat is richer in vitamin A.
Loquat's daily need coverage for vitamin A is 30% higher.
Durian has 20 times more vitamin C than loquat. Durian has 19.7mg of vitamin C, while loquat has 1mg.
